10:50 – James Inhofe’s questioning of Hagel was quite a bit softer than I’d expected. GOP senators had once promised to do everything they could to block the Hagel nomination and said they thought they might have the votes to do so. If Inhofe is any indication, they’ve pretty much thrown in the towel. Inhofe just made a point of praising Hagel as a good friend and said “if you are confirmed” in a tone which suggested that that was precisely what he expected to happen.
